Blue's Surprise at Two O'Clock is the twelfth episode of Blue's Clues from Season 2. It was the thirty-second episode to be produced and the thirty-third to be aired.
Blue has a special surprise, but it will not be ready till 2:00 and at the start of the episode, it is only 1:40 by Steve's watch. He does not think he can wait that long to find out what it is, but Blue helps out by having him play Blue's Clues to pass the time. Soon, the first clue, orange juice is found. Time is something which Tickety thinks she could use some help on, as her hands seem to be stuck at 1:00. So we help her out by showing her which way to move her hands in order to go forward in time and reach 2:00. Later, Blue and Steve skidoo into Tickety's favorite nursery rhyme, where they play a game called Race Against Time. In this game, the objective is to identify a slowly revealed picture within fifteen seconds. Soon, the third clue, an ice cube tray is found and the answer turns out to be orange juice pops. Later everyone enjoys Blue's surprise and we also learn how to do it for ourselves. Steve sings the So Long Song and the episode ends.
This is the first episode where the viewers did not say There she is! in the intro.
Steve's hair is shorter.
Events in this episode definitely do "not" occur in real-time. The displayed clock starts out 1:40. Later, it reads 1:45, even though only about three minutes have passed. And throughout, the times never really seem to match up.
This is the first time that one of the kids (Steve's Friends) at the end of the Video Letter segment, gives him something from the letter, which turns out to be a clue.
This is the first of two times where Steve did not actually ask the question for Blue's Clues: He said, "Well, it's gonna be hard to wait, Blue, but maybe if we had some hints, or some clues..." Blue then placed her single pawprint.
It took longer for the mail to come.
This is the first time Mailbox delivers the mail late. The second time will be The Baby's Here!, but only by accident.
Grandfather Clock appeared on the pages of "Hickory Dickory Dock", but the skidoo location takes place inside him. Also, the voice of Grandfather Clock was later heard as "Big Booming Voice" in Look Carefully....
The items on the refrigerator are letter magnets that spell "TIME" (the T and I hold a paper plate clock) on the top door (the freezer area), and number magnets that form another clock (two bigger 1s form the hands) on the bottom door.
